【Git 使用 04】如何放弃本地修改
1. 通过git checkout -- filepathname命令放弃特定文件的修改。例如:2. 若想放弃所有文件的修改,则可忽略特定路径。若已修改了本地文件,并且使用了git add操作,放弃修改的步骤如下:1. 首先执行git reset HEAD filepathname命令,先放弃缓存状态,然后才能放弃更改。例如:2. 为了放弃所有文件的缓存...
[How To] 使用Git的时候,如何撤销本地更改
Git规定,在本地变更没有提交的时候,不能够同步其它版本库的更新到对本地,为了防止本地变更丢失,如果本地变更只是一些试验性的调试语句,那就可以完全抛弃(discard),可以使用checkout命令进行撤销。如果只是急于同步最新的变化,又不想把当前的变更丢弃,同样,也不想把当前的变更给提交的话(真变态...
git实战技巧-如何撤销本地刚做出的修改、暂存和已提交
1. 使用IDEA解决首先,撤销工作区的内容,可以在Git工具窗口中直接操作,或者右键文件选择Git并执行Rollback。对于暂存区,IDEA默认更新后直接提交,无需额外操作,回退到特定版本时,通过Git工具窗口查看提交记录,选择需要的版本并点击Reset。2. 使用Git命令解决对于工作区的修改,使用`git checkout --file...
git如何放弃所有本地修改
当你需要放弃git中所有本地的修改时,有几种方法可供选择。首先,可以使用git checkout命令,这会撤销所有未提交的更改,将工作目录恢复到之前的提交状态。如果希望保留部分修改,可以使用git stash功能,将未提交的修改暂存到stash中,然后使用git stash pop来恢复。另一种方法是利用git reset命令,git r...
git如何放弃所有本地修改
使用git命令行工具,可以通过执行`git checkout -- .`命令来放弃所有本地修改。详细解释:在使用git进行版本控制时,有时我们可能需要进行一些本地修改,但又决定放弃这些修改,希望回到上一次提交的状态。在这种情况下,可以使用以下步骤来放弃所有本地修改:1. git checkout命令简介:`git checkout`...
【git】git取消本地的操作
接着,使用git reflog命令查看所有已执行的命令,找到回退到合并前状态的版本号。执行命令:git reflog 在输出结果中,查找合并之前的版本号,记下该版本号。然后使用git reset --hard命令,将本地仓库回退到指定的版本号:git reset --hard f82cfd2 如果未提交更改并且需要更直接的方法,可以采取以下...
Git放弃本地所有更改
在使用Git时,若需放弃本地所有更改,主要分为四种情况:未加入暂存区、已加入暂存区、已提交至本地仓库及强制与远程同步。对于未加入暂存区的文件,可直接使用命令:通过此命令可放弃所有未加入缓存区的修改,包括内容修改与整个文件的删除。然而,此操作不会影响刚新建的文件,因其尚未被Git管理系统识别...
如何高效撤销Git管理的文件在各种状态下的更改
一、撤销更改方案 1. 未提交暂存区:使用git checkout file-name撤销单个文件修改;使用git checkout .撤销所有文件更改。2. 已提交暂存区,未推送到远程仓库:首先,查找待回滚commitId。然后,使用git reset --hard commitId回退版本。最后,如果更改已推送到远程仓库,需使用git push -f origin ...
Git——放弃 Git 中的更改
在面对不确定是否保留的本地更改时,我们可以选择使用stash功能暂时保存它们。将所有更改保存于Git的stash中,便于日后需要时恢复。借助stash,我们可以使用pop命令提交上次保存的状态并从stash中移除和清理它,灵活管理更改。多实践,多探索,多理解,坚持不懈,加油!掌握Git技能,探索更多分支,理解如何强制...
如何在 Git 里撤销任何操作
在Git中,如果你误将修改推送至GitHub并希望撤销特定的commit,有一个简单且安全的方法可以实现。当你需要撤销一个已推送的commit时,可以使用命令git revert 。这个操作的原理是,git revert会生成一个新的commit,这个新的commit与指定的SHA commit是相反的,即它会“撤销”之前的更改。如果之前的commit...